From 626066f1343ede64c1bf95b79c5b4973b94eb356 Mon Sep 17 00:00:00 2001 From: Robert Alessi Date: Thu, 11 Oct 2018 12:54:46 +0200 Subject: included indnum() into ayah() --- arabluatex.dtx | 6 +++--- arabluatex.lua | 3 +-- 2 files changed, 4 insertions(+), 5 deletions(-) diff --git a/arabluatex.dtx b/arabluatex.dtx index 4173695..23a4f38 100644 --- a/arabluatex.dtx +++ b/arabluatex.dtx @@ -27,7 +27,7 @@ %\NeedsTeXFormat{LaTeX2e}[1999/12/01] %\ProvidesPackage{arabluatex} %<*package-info> - [2018/10/09 v1.15 An ArabTeX-like interface for LuaLaTeX] + [2018/10/11 v1.15.1 An ArabTeX-like interface for LuaLaTeX] % % %<*driver> @@ -158,7 +158,7 @@ \usepackage{newunicodechar} \newunicodechar{ǧ}{ǧ} % Old Standard does not include ǧ/Ǧ \newunicodechar{Ǧ}{Ǧ} % -\usepackage{arabluatex}[2018/10/09] +\usepackage{arabluatex}[2018/10/11] \usepackage[nopar]{quran} \usepackage[noindex]{nameauth} \usepackage{varioref} @@ -4299,7 +4299,7 @@ wa-ya.sIru ta.hta 'l-jild-i % \begin{macrocode} \NeedsTeXFormat{LaTeX2e} \ProvidesPackage{arabluatex}% -[2018/10/09 v1.15 An ArabTeX-like interface for LuaLaTeX] +[2018/10/11 v1.15.1 An ArabTeX-like interface for LuaLaTeX] \RequirePackage{ifluatex} % \end{macrocode} % \package{arabluatex} requires \hologo{LuaLaTeX} of course. Issue a diff --git a/arabluatex.lua b/arabluatex.lua index 58bc584..09c1acb 100644 --- a/arabluatex.lua +++ b/arabluatex.lua @@ -1162,8 +1162,7 @@ end function ayah(str) if tonumber(str) ~= nil and str.len(str) < 4 then if tex.textdir == "TRT" then --- str = "\\arb[novoc]{"..str.."^^^^06dd}" - str = str.."^^^^06dd" + str = indnum(str).."^^^^06dd" elseif tex.textdir == "TLT" then str = "\\arb[trans]{("..str..")}" end -- cgit v1.2.3